Andhra Pradesh Chief Minister YS Jagan Mohan Reddy on Monday disbursed Rs 680 crore under Jagananna Vidya Devena fee reimbursement scheme at Nagari in Chittoor district.

Andhra CM allocates Rs 680 cr for fee reimbursement to students

The amount was credited into the bank accounts of more than 8.4 lakh women, mothers of those 9.3 lakh students.
